My latest 4000 has me scratching my head. I have a single acting loader on this tractor and have the valve set for one way cylinders. The problem is that it seems to bleed down while it's parked and takes for ever to start to raise the loader the first time after starting it up. The 3pt goes right up starting tho. It's fine after that. The other thing is if I shut the tractor off with the bucket in the air it will not let me lower it to the ground unless I bump the starter. The biggest problem is if I pickup a decent load it will not go back down until I change the adjustment screw to double acting, then it drops like a rock. I have several of the same vintage of Ford's and haven't had this scenario before. Sorry for long post but I can't figure this out!!

That is a detented, load check valve. In other words, unless oil is moving (engine running) nothing will happen. Apparently it has a bad o-ring or two. Normally a loader hooked to that valve will stay in one position forever!! That said, that valve is far from bring ideal for a loader. You're either up, down, or holding, no in between. A nice valve for pull behind cylinders though!. There is a parts break down of the valve in the 53-59 master parts book

Properly set up this valve should lift from the front port with the lever back, and drop with the lever forward which will pressurize the back port until you open the little t-handle which will make it a one-way operation, which I think would make the loader operate better.
